The 'my-first-learn-to-read-books' series is a collection of beginner-friendly reading books designed to help young children develop foundational literacy skills. Featuring simple vocabulary, engaging illustrations, and interactive elements, these books aim to foster a love for reading while teaching basic phonics and sight words.

Key Features

  • Age-appropriate content for early readers
  • Bright, colorful illustrations to engage young learners
  • Simple sentences and repetitive text to build confidence
  • Phonics-based approach for decoding skills
  • Interactive activities such as flaps or puzzles in some editions
  • Progressive difficulty levels to track development

Pros

  • Effective for building early reading skills
  • Encourages a love for reading through engaging visuals
  • Suitable for independent practice or guided learning
  • Affordable and widely available

Cons

  • Limited complexity may not challenge more advanced young readers
  • Quality can vary between editions or publishers
  • Some books might rely heavily on repetition without introducing new vocabulary
